Overall Meaning

In VNV Nation's song "Sentinel," the lyrics seem to reflect on the current state of the world, questioning whether or not we can truly say we are free. The hands being bound and voices being silenced suggest a lack of agency and control, and the need to wake up to the reality of the situation. The singer refuses to accept the status quo, arguing that redemption can be found in aftermath, and that the causes for change are often disguised as revolution. The call to "quell the rage" and "dismantle the machine" speaks to a desire to take down the oppressive systems that keep us bound.


The chorus of the song explores the idea of dreaming of better days to come, in a world where songs of glory and victory parades celebrate a better world. Despite the storm that has just begun, the singer still holds onto hope for a better future.


Overall, "Sentinel" seems to be a call to action, urging listeners to open their eyes to the current state of the world and take steps to dismantle the systems of oppression that keep us bound. It acknowledges the difficulty of this task, but also emphasizes the hope and potential for a better future.
